@kayten

 

There are no such things as premier accounts now as its been merged.

 

You can have >

 

1. Personal / Premier account.

2. Business account.

 

So if you are not a registered business buying in stock to re-sell then you are fine selling on your personal account which is in fact a personal / premier account.

 

You have probably found an outdated page.
